Black-cheeked Gnateater
The Black-cheeked Gnateater is a small, plump bird of humid forest in coastal Brazil, with males bearing a distinctive bold black cheek patch and a white postocular tuft against chestnut-brown plumage. It inhabits the dense undergrowth and forest floor of Atlantic Forest in eastern Brazil. It feeds on insects and other small invertebrates, foraging secretively near the ground.
